Deskbar applet ships with a handler to search in a users bookmarks. It
autodetects if a users default browser is firefox or epiphany
This autodetection is broken and causes the bookmark search handler not
to load.
Reason:
BrowserMatch.py checks the gconf key /desktop/gnome/url-handlers/http/ for the
presence of either the firefox of epiphany string and loads the appropriate
handler
Unfortunately the said key contains gnome-www-browser %s so neither
extension is loaded
I presume that gnome-www-browser is an intermediary which checks the
/gnome/applications/browser/exec gconf key for which web browser to
launch
To Repeat:
1) Remove deskbar from the panel
2) execute /usr/lib/deskbar-applet/deskbar-applet -w
3) Notice how none of the epiphany, galeon or firefox/mozilla handlers are
loaded
